Dragonball GT – Transformation

 

Dragon Ball GT: Transformation is a side-scroller beat ’em up video game developed by Webfoot Technologies and published by Atari for the Game Boy Advance in North America. The story takes place during the “Black Star Dragon Balls” and “Baby” story arcs of the anime series Dragon Ball GTTransformation was re-released in 2006 as part of a Game Boy Advance two-pack, which includes Dragon Ball Z: Buu’s Fury on the same cartridge.

Gameplay

The gameplay is based on the standard classic “beat-’em-up” subgenre of fighting games, similar to games such as Sega’s Streets of Rage series, or Konami’s Teenage Mutant Ninja Turtles games.

Game modes

Dragon Ball GT: Transformation sports multiple modes of play, but the story mode is the only one available from the beginning. The other gameplay modes must be unlocked by the player by purchasing them with acquired zenie, which is rewarded to the player at the end of each stage, based on their performance. The player’s total points are converted into zenie, and bonuses are rewarded based on multiple factors such as time, combos, and power-ups obtained.
